Sony Releases EverQuest II Extended Beta

It's a tough market out there right now if you're not World of Warcraft. Sony Online Entertainment has just launched the beta for the free-to-play EverQuest II Extended, which opens up parts of the subscription game for free play.

The neat trick with Extended is that it runs though a web-based application, giving potential subscribers an easier route into the game.

WHAT: Starting today, players can experience the dark and dangerous depths of Norrath without a subscription with the release of SOE’s new free adventure service, EverQuest® II Extended Beta! SOE has liberated portions of the critically acclaimed PC franchise, EverQuest II, including five plus years of impressive, award-winning content, for free. EverQuest II Extended joins the highly successful EverQuest II live subscription service, and together they provide EQII players with a choice of either a subscription-based or free-to-play business model, thus offering two distinct experiences operating in parallel, which is a first in the MMO industry. ABOUT EXTENDED: Extended also provides players with quick and convenient game access through a new web-based streaming download application that lets players get into the game quicker than ever before. Extended also includes the recently improved EQII user-interface and Golden Path progression system!

WHEN: The scheduled release date for EverQuest II Extended Open Beta is August 19, 2010. Platinum Membership is scheduled to release on August 31, 2010.
